The Constitution states that everyone is equal before the law, but Prime Minister Edi Rama's project to guarantee the inviolability of the state and power caste is the clearest example that some officials will not submit, even by law, to this equality.

Using the case of Minister Balluku in the face of the request of SPAK and GJKKO, Edi Rama has initiated parliamentary procedures with SP deputies to amend Article 242 of the Criminal Procedure Code, with the obvious aim of avoiding legal action against himself.

Edi Rama has presented this self-defense and avoidance of facing justice while in office as a guarantee measure under the term "functional immunity", so that some senior officials are not suspended from duty in the event of criminal proceedings.

In addition to his function as Prime Minister, Edi Rama has also included in the status of untouchables with "functional immunity" the Deputy Prime Minister, ministers, the President of the Republic, members of the Constitutional Court, the Ombudsman, the Chairman of the Supreme State Audit Office and the Governor of the Bank of Albania.

These were not included for reasons of state functioning, but to present the draft as a legal amendment in the name of institutional stability, so that the judiciary would not suspend some heads of institutions mandated by Parliament.

Many state officials are mandated by Parliament, whom Edi Rama did not include in draft Article 242 of the Criminal Procedure Code, but left without "functional immunity".

Edi Rama's draft allows for the suspension from duty of the Secretary General of the Prime Minister's Office, members of the High Court, the Prosecutor General, the Director of SHISH, the leaders of ILD, KLP, KLGJ, AKEP, the Public Procurement Commission and the Asset Control Inspectorate.

With a parliamentary mandate, but without "functional immunity", i.e. with the right to be suspended from justice in the event of criminal proceedings, also remain the Commissioner for Civil Service Supervision, the Election Commissioner, the Chairman of the Competition Authority, the Commissioner for the Right to Information and Protection of Personal Data, the Commissioner for Protection from Discrimination and about 20 other high state positions.

All these officials can be suspended from office following criminal proceedings, except for deputies and mayors, who are provided for in the current Article 242 of the Code of Criminal Procedure.

With the addition proposed by Edi Rama, the judiciary will not be able to suspend from office the Prime Minister, the President of the Republic, members of the Constitutional Court, the Ombudsman, the Chairman of the Supreme Audit Office and the Governor of the Bank of Albania, even in the event of serious violations.
